A physiotherapy degree with foundation year is designed for students who do not meet the usual entry requirements for a traditional physiotherapy program. This may be due to a variety of factors, such as not having studied the appropriate subjects at A-level or equivalent, or not achieving the required grades. The foundation year bridges this gap by providing students with the necessary knowledge and skills to succeed in their future studies.
During the foundation year, students will typically study core subjects such as biology, anatomy, and physiology, as well as essential study skills such as academic writing and research. This enables students to develop a solid understanding of the human body and how it functions, which is fundamental to a career in physiotherapy. In addition, the foundation year will help students to improve their critical thinking, problem-solving, and communication skills, all of which are essential for practicing as a physiotherapist.
